Sun Conjunction Pluto

Sun-Pluto Conjunction

(Transit Sun → Natal Pluto)

Various sources for the child’s horoscope

Such a child may be drawn to superheroes—ordinary people who transform into powerful beings. They will strive to emulate such figures, displaying boldness and self-confidence. The child must understand that there are right and wrong ways to use personal power. Otherwise, they may resort to using their strength in fights and quarrels. Family issues, such as a parent’s divorce or loss, can amplify the feeling of being stripped of their power and will. Parents and teachers should allow such children to recognize their own significance but must not tolerate any insolence or cruelty toward themselves or others. The child may perceive their parent as all-knowing and omnipotent or, conversely, as insolent and merciless (these qualities arise in the child’s imagination through observations of life situations).

Het Monster. Aspects

They possess great energetic potential and the ability to penetrate to the essence of things. If they fail to align divine will with their own, they risk becoming dictators due to a power complex, which leads to ruin. They must learn tolerance. A desire to dominate and gain recognition. In negative aspects—danger of accidents, catastrophes, life crises, friction with authority, and an inability to submit.

Catherine Aubier. Astrological Dictionary

Conjunction: an aspect of hidden power, consciously concealed, granting great opportunities for skillful manipulation of others, like a “Deus ex machina” in ancient theater. Strong will, a tendency toward self-assertion, not owing anyone anything, living by their own mind. The ability to change everything, to question everything. Psychologically, the parental model holds great significance, but this model is either poorly realized or becomes unacceptable.

Avesalom Podvodny. Aspects

Sun conjunction: “If you call yourself a nut, climb into the barrel.” A planet’s conjunction with the Sun gives its manifestations a tone of imperativeness—at a high level of processing the aspect. At a low level, imperativeness relates more to the necessity of processing the planet. The Sun illuminates the lower manifestations of its principle and actualizes it, primarily through direct pressure. At a low level of processing the Sun, it acts through rigid imperatives imposed on the planet, suppressing its creative essence and forcing its principle to manifest within narrowly defined limits it cannot contain; excessive internal tension arises, leading to an explosion, where the Absolute’s creativity manifests both in the moment and nature of the explosion (unpredictable in advance) and in the form and trajectory of the debris. If the conjunction is unprocessed but stands harmoniously, these explosions will be more dangerous to others, and the planet’s creative essence will only appear as a path of rigidly egoistic consumption in spheres corresponding to its principle. For example, an unprocessed Sun-Mars conjunction produces great but futile activity, which the person themselves may perceive as extraordinarily important and useful, while also having the ability to completely drain another person’s energy, leaving them literally without strength or even a hint of gratitude. Processing the conjunction (and the Sun) will shift it to a higher egregor, where the Sun’s initiative acts above the level of rigid command, serving as a guide for desired directions of activity and, most importantly, attention. Then, the interaction between the Sun and the planet becomes significantly easier, and the planet receives from the Sun a kind of weak magnetization, serving as orientation in complex (for the planet) conditions when the optimal choice is unclear. Pluto conjunction: Fate, pursuing a person, does not set itself the task of catching up to them. In the spheres governed by the planet in conjunction with Pluto, the person will feel the breath of renewal; with strong energy, those around them, especially those activating the planet, will also feel it. The meaning of this renewal lies in cleansing and transforming the principle of the planet as it materializes in the person’s fate, determined not only by the natal chart but also by the person’s life choices. At a low level, the person may feel as though misfortunes and irreversible losses lurk in the spheres governed by the planet, and here they must cultivate humility and learn to work on higher vibrations of the corresponding flows; otherwise, they may face the most unpleasant consequences (if the planet is harmonious in the surrounding context). The peculiarity of processing a conjunction with Pluto lies in the fact that Pluto never considers a person clean enough, and in the areas of life where the planet’s principle is active, the person will feel this acutely. Processing here is expressed in changing the tools Pluto uses: a garbage machine and bin, a broom and dustpan, or a brush and cigarette paper. At a high level, this aspect grants deep penetration into existential issues of the house where the conjunction stands, as well as the spheres governed by the planet, the ability to finely process its principle, and the capacity to resolve major karmic issues in the corresponding fields with minor influences.

Frances Sakoian. Aspects

Their power potential manifests as the ability to regenerate and transform themselves and their surroundings. They possess incredibly great energy and the ability to delve into the essence of things. Pluto is the ruler of the ability to penetrate dimensions and uncover sources of fundamental energy. This primordial energy manifests as sexual potency, which can be expressed spiritually or physically. Access to higher realms of consciousness is possible, and these people may become instruments of divine will. If they fail to align their will with the divine, they risk becoming dictators due to a power complex, leading to their destruction. They must learn tolerance.

S.V. Shestopalov. Aspects of Planets

These are aspects of self-assertion, the struggle for popularity, power, success; they bring dictatorship, a desire to command, authoritarianism, conflicts with others, intolerance, carelessness, recklessness, impatience; a tendency toward accidents, danger of surgical operations, inflammatory diseases. The positive side—striving for popularity can be a stimulus for self-improvement; these aspects can grant the ability to achieve set goals and the skill to win.
